You can also ...Oct 24, 2023 · If that amount is reached during a qualified offering within the term, the startup would convert your note at the discounted rate. So, say shares normally cost $1 per share—with your discount, you’d be converted at 75 cents per share. Thus, your $100,000 would be converted into 133,333 shares ($100,000 x $0.75). When you invest in a startup via a crowdfunding site, you’ll have a contract with the company you invest in. There are different ways to invest including lending to the startup company. The main types are as follows: Debt: You’ll receive interest in exchange for lending to the startup company. Equity: You will buy shares in the startup ...

You may also wish …Investment made by AngelList India into an Indian portfolio company shall be reckoned as an Indirect Foreign Investment for the Indian startup as per foreign exchange laws of India. The investment manager of AngelList India is a foreign owned and controlled entity hence the investment qualifies as a Downstream Investment. ‍ A separate scheme ...
